FALN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2018 in Review
15 of the 4,373 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ares Fallen Angels USD Bond ETF (FALN) for Q1 2018, worth a combined $15.9M — up 233% from $4.76M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 8 funds opened new FALN positions and 2 closed out — a net gain of 6 holders — while 3 added to existing stakes and 2 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Gradient Investments, adding an estimated $4.73M. The largest seller was Formidable Asset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$1.15M sold.
